ROBBIE Williams is becoming a human homage to fallen showbiz greats.

We revealed that the former Take That star has paid the ultimate tribute to late James Bond actor Sir Roger Moore by getting a tattoo in his honour.

Now Robbie has had another inking done to remember a lost legend from the music industry.

This time, Robbie has had the initials DE inked on his wrist as a dedication to his former manager David Enthoven, who passed away on August 11 last year at the age of 72.

David was Rob’s manager for more than 20 years after he quit Take That.

At the time Rob took to Twitter to pay his respect, saying: “My Friend, Mentor and Hero passed away today.

“David Enthoven, I love you. RIP.” And he performed at the music industry veteran’s funeral alongside producer Guy Chambers on guitar.

Along with the Roger Moore tatt, Robbie has also dedicated a place on his body to the late comedy great Ronnie Corbett, and had a neck tattoo symbolisin­g The Two Ronnies done last year. Robbie’s now up to a grand total of 26 tattoos, including many more touching tributes to his family (grandfathe­r, nan, mum, wife, and son).

Plus he has a nod to The Beatles with the lyrics from hit All You Need is Love across his lower back.
